Headliner backing?
I just picked up a roll of Nautolex headliner on ebay and am trying to
figure out the best way to install it. It needs some sort of backing to keep it from sagging so my first thought was 1/8" masonite but masonite doesn't resist moisture very well. Okoume is to expensive. Any ideas for a thin sheet good that is moisture resistant, inexpensive and will take a spray adhesive? -- Glenn Ashmore I'm building a 45' cutter in strip/composite.
